Digital billboards are coming to Galesburg. A Missouri-based company has acquired property rights and applied for permits to locate two-sided billboards at a pair of high-traffic locations — one at the intersection of Main and Henderson streets, and the other near Home Boulevard and Carl Sandburg Drive.

Wesley Bell, general manager of Robinson Outdoor of Perryville, Missouri, tells WGIL the digital billboards will feature seven slots on each side, allowing for 14 customers at each site.

In addition to slots for advertisers, the city of Galesburg will be allowed a portion of the billboard time to promote community events or notices. Also, weather alerts such as tornado warnings would be displayed, taking precedence over advertising.

“It’s a great way for the city to communicate with the citizens about things going on in Galesburg,” Bell said.

Robinson Outdoor has approximately 155 digital faces throughout the country, the nearest location in Kewanee. The company started in Missouri and has expanded to Iowa, Illinois and Kentucky.

According to Knox County property transfers, Robinson Real Estate Easement Company LLC acquired the property at 343 Home Blvd.—located across the street from Lowe’s Home Improvement—from Cody Krech on Tuesday for $300,000.

Bell said Robinson Outdoor will sell the recently-acquired land at 343 Home Blvd.—most likely for further retail development.

“We’re in communication with a few developers in the Illinois market, and they build a variety of things from Jimmy John’s to Scooter’s Coffee to other restaurants,” Bell said. “It’s being heavily spoken about.”

The billboard at Henderson and Main streets is located near Nature’s Treatment of Illinois.

Bell said he anticipates the signs being installed in Galesburg sometime in mid-April. Since the sign at Henderson and Main will face state highways, Robinson Outdoor is required to get state permits for that location.
